Chimney Tops Trail
Chimney Tops Trail is a short, very steep climb. At 5.5 TEP it sits around the middle of the catalogue. Its steepest 500 metres run at 25.0% and start 492 m in, in the middle of the climb, so pace the first part. Most runners need 16 to 28 minutes.
